Box Score The Wabash tennis team traveled to play ninth-ranked Washington University-St. Louis Saturday. The Little Giants scored two impressive doubles victories in the 6-3 defeat at the hands of the Bears.
William Reifeis and
Patrick McAuley won their 16
th consecutive number one doubles match of the season. The duo defeated Konrad Kozlowski and Benjamin vander Sman 8-6 to stay undefeated.
Nicholas Pollock and
Kirill Ivashchenko combined for an 8-6 victory at number three doubles to give Wabash (8-8) a 2-1 lead heading into single play.
Washington University (7-5) earned wins in five of the six singles matches. McAuley posted the lone win for the Little Giants with a 7-5, 6-4 straight-sets victory over Jason Haugen.
Wabash heads to Rose-Hulman March 28 before playing Elmurst at home on March 31.
